How Many Panels Fit? The Millimeter Game
So, what's the magic number? Well... it depends. Standard 60-cell panels (approx 1.7m x 1m) allow ~550-600 units per 40ft high-cube container. But 2024's shift to larger 78-cell designs changes everything. Let's break it down:
| Panel Type | Dimensions (m) | Units Per Container | Total kW Capacity |
|---|---|---|---|
| 60-cell (Standard) | 1.7 x 1.0 x 0.04 | 550-600 | 220-240kW |
| 72-cell (Utility) | 2.0 x 1.0 x 0.04 | 450-500 | 270-300kW |
| 78-cell (New Gen) | 2.2 x 1.1 x 0.04 | 380-420 | 342-378kW |
*Based on 12.8m internal length, 2.35m width, 2.69m height with palletization
See how 78-cell units deliver more kW despite fewer pieces? That's tier 2 optimization. But wait—here's where suppliers make or break you. The Packing Variables That Bite Back
Why the range in our table? Three sneaky factors: First, pallet height—stack six panels high and you risk microcracks. Second, packaging thickness. Those 5cm foam corners add up! Third, humidity sensors. Non-negotiable for ocean freight. Forget these and you'll get ratio'd hard when panels arrive with snail trails. Ever seen corrosion bloom across glass? Choosing Your Container Supplier: Beyond Price Tags
When vetting suppliers, cheapest is often... well, cheugy. The real MVPs offer four things: First, panel-specific crating that eliminates wasted airspace. Second, real-time container tracking—none of that "last seen 3 weeks ago" nonsense. Third, climate-controlled options for tropical routes. Fourth, and most crucially, they run load tests with your exact panels. I recall a supplier who sent us CAD mockups showing how frame thickness altered stacking. Saved us 11% space!

Logistics Hacks: Shipping Like a Pro
Okay, let's get tactical. Always request "floor loading" when possible—removes pallet height limits. Use vertical sleeves for thin-film panels; they fit 22% more than crystalline. And for Pete's sake, invest in corner protectors! $2/unit insurance against $300 replacements. Major suppliers now offer AI-powered density reports showing weight distribution heatmaps.
